Mailinglisten-Archive |
Hallo Dietmar, ok: Annahme: Tabelle 1 sieht so aus -------------------------- | M_Key | MannschaftName | -------------------------- > Ne, Tabelle 2 enthält die Gruppen (ZB. A,B,C,D) und den M_Key und > zusätzlich natürlich einen G_Key somit Tabelle 2 ----------------- | M_Key | G_Key | ----------------- so wäre aber Gruppe von G_Key abhängig und sollte in eine extra Tabelle (Normalisierung) s.u. > Die Tabelle 2 enthält nun die G_Key der Mannschaft 1, den G_Key der ^^3, oder?! > Mannschaft 2 und den G_Key des Schiri. > Nun soll die Tabell 3 ausgegeben werden, jedoch anstatt der G_Keys die > Mannschaftsnamen, die in der Tabelle1 gespeicherten sind, aber über > Tabelle2 neu sortiert bzw einer Gruppe zugeordnet werden. Es gibt aber doch dann sicher mehrere Mannschaften in einer Gruppe, das heisst, Tabelle 3 definiert dann keine eindeutige Mannschaftszugehörigkeit. also eher doch wie ich anfangs hatte: Tabelle 3 --------------------------- | M1_Key | M2_Key | G_Key | ---------------------------- und Tabelle 4 --------------------------- | G_Key | Gruppe | Schiri | ---------------------------- > Das ist deshalb notwendig, da sich die Gruppenzugehörigkeit ändern kann, > aber die Keys der Mannschaften (Tabelle1) fix bleiben müssen (weite > Tabellen mit Details) >> Subselects? >> in der Version 4.1 geplant: >> http://www.mysql.com/doc/en/ANSI_diff_Sub-> selects.html > War vor einem Jahr auch schon so - oder? kann durchaus sein ;-) ciao Christoph Loeffler --- Infos zur Mailingliste, zur Teilnahme und zum An- und Abmelden unter -->> http://www.4t2.com/mysql
php::bar PHP Wiki - Listenarchive